An optical interferometer which measures the radial pulsations of gas bubbles in liquids withAngstrom sensitivity is described. The gas-liquid interfaces act as mirrors. The interferometer,intrinsically differential, is insensitive to the overall movement of the bubble and to vibrations ofthe optical components. Examples of the resonance behavior of oxygen bubbles in water aregiven.
